-
Software Development
CI/CD Tools: GitLab vs Jenkins
CI/CD is an acronym that stands for Continuous Integration and Continuous Deployment/Delivery. It is a set of practices used in…
Read More » -
Web Development
Data Binding in React
Data binding is a software development technique that allows developers to establish a connection between the data source and the…
Read More » -
Core Java
Java Concurrency: ReentRantLock Fairness
Previously we saw some of the building blocks of concurrency in Java. In this blog we will focus on ReentRantLock.…
Read More » -
Ruby
10 Popular Ruby Testing Frameworks for 2023
Ruby is a dynamic, object-oriented programming language that is designed to be easy to read and write. It was created…
Read More » -
Software Development
Choosing The Right Streaming Database
Streaming databases, also known as real-time databases or time-series databases, are becoming increasingly popular in today’s data-driven world. These databases…
Read More » -
Software Development
The Complete 2023 Cyber Security Developer & IT Skills Bundle
Hey fellow geeks, This week, on our JCG Deals store, we have another extreme offer. We are offering a massive…
Read More » -
Software Development
API Gateway Migration Automation
An API Gateway is a server that acts as an intermediary between a client and a set of backend services.…
Read More » -
Software Development
Starting with Windows PowerShell Cheatsheet
1. Introduction PowerShell is a command-line shell and scripting language developed by Microsoft for task automation and configuration management. It…
Read More » -
DevOps
DevOps vs Agile: Key Differences and Similarities in Terms Of Efficiency
DevOps and Agile are both methodologies that have become increasingly popular in the software development industry in recent years. Agile…
Read More »